Unable to connect to network printer

After installing Mavericks i cannot print anymore on my network printer.

The printer has connected to a Windows XP pc, i see it under settings Windows printer but when i launch a print the printer goes into pause state. The message i see is "unable to connect to printer".

I had this connection since Snow Leopard > Mountain Lion and it has always worked.

Andrea,

Thanks for posting the link. I tried what the article said to do but it did not solve the problem. I created the nsmb.conf file as instructed, rebooted, readded the printer but got the same result "unable to connect".

I also tried adding a CIFS connection directly to the printer in the Advanced tab of the Printer Dialog but as long as CIFS// was the server type, the Add button was not active.

As of 10.8, unable to use the network print function. Despite clearing the printers etc. I can't have a printer on a MBP 10.8 or 10.9 and have a MPB running 10.7 print to it. However, if the printer is on the 10.7 MBP there's no problem in printing to it from the 10.8 or 10.9 MBP. It's obviously been broken since 10.8.
